Mirimichi Golf Club is a public 18-hole golf course located in Millington, Tennessee. Established in 1976 and designed by architect Bob Mitchell, the course offers golfers a somewhat challenging playing experience. The facility provides comprehensive practice amenities, including a driving range, golf school, indoor practice facilities, and access to a teaching professional.
